(FULL) Sourdough Bread Making

Sourdough Bread MakingRegistration for this program is full. Cost: $10 per person. Learn all the ins and outs to making your own sourdough bread! Lauren Horvat from "Starting All Things Sourdough" will be leading this learning session teaching all the tips and tricks to making your own delicious loaves. Come prepared with your questions and leave with your own starter kit! Your starter will be active in a few weeks time, just in time for the colder months and soup season. For ages 14.

PA Business One-Stop Shop (BOSS) Overview

bcc12:00 pm in the BCC Classroom 

Join us at this workshop and Q&A session with The PA Department of Community and Economic Development (DCED) and their innovative PA Business One-Stop Shop (BOSS). In this exciting new collaboration, the BCC will offer opportunities for entrepreneurs to grow and / or hone their ideas and their businesses. 

BOSS guides businesses through all stages of development — from planning and startup to operating and expanding. Whether you are an aspiring entrepreneur or existing business, BOSS provides complete, customer focused service. They help connect entrepreneurs and business owners with specific opportunities and partner networks for one-on-one counseling, training, and business assistance and work closely with colleagues across state government and economic development networks to gather the best resources to guide you through all stages of business development, including: 

• Details on planning a business, registration and permitting, hiring employees, finding financing, training, and more 

• Information for diverse businesses and training and best practices on important business topics including eCommerce 

• Connection to trusted partners and funding opportunities 

Come with whatever questions or concerns you have, in whatever stage of your business development you are in, and learn about this excellent resource. Opportunities abound!
